The Appeal of Designer Fashion
Luxury brands are synonymous with quality, craftsmanship, and exclusivity. Designer pieces often feature:
- Superior Materials: High-quality fabrics, durable stitching, and expert tailoring.
- Timeless Designs: Classic silhouettes and iconic details that rarely go out of style.
- Status & Statement: Wearing designer items can elevate your confidence and make a fashion statement.
When it’s worth it: Designer fashion is an investment if you’re looking for pieces that will last years, become wardrobe staples, or hold value over time — like classic handbags, tailored coats, or elegant shoes.
Consideration: The high price tag isn’t just for the product; you’re paying for brand prestige and craftsmanship.
The Strength of High-Street Fashion
High-street brands bring style to the masses. Their advantages include:
- Affordability: You can experiment with trends without breaking the bank.
- Variety: Frequent releases allow you to explore different colors, patterns, and silhouettes.
- Accessibility: Easy to find and shop, both online and in stores.
When it’s worth it: High-street fashion is perfect for seasonal trends, statement pieces, or wardrobe experiments. If you love trying bold prints, bright colors, or oversized styles that may be out of fashion next season, this is the smart route.
Consideration: Some fast-fashion items may sacrifice quality and longevity, so careful selection is key.
How to Decide
Invest in Staples: Allocate your budget to classic items that define your wardrobe — like a tailored coat, quality leather boots, or a structured handbag. These are items you’ll wear season after season.
Experiment With Trends: Use high-street fashion for statement pieces and trends. A bold jacket, printed skirt, or colorful top can be trendy without costing a fortune.
Mix and Match: Luxury doesn’t have to be head-to-toe. Pair a designer bag with high-street jeans, or wear a high-quality blazer with budget-friendly accessories. This balance creates style and practicality.
The Bottom Line
Luxury fashion is about investment, quality, and timeless pieces. High-street fashion is about experimentation, affordability, and accessibility. The smartest wardrobes blend both worlds — investing in long-lasting staples while staying playful with seasonal finds.
